Johnny Ray Messer

August 30, 1958 — June 21, 2023

Johnny Ray Messer, 64, a resident of Bokeelia, FL for the past 53 years, formerly of Cleveland, OH, passed away Wednesday, June 21, 2023 in Bokeelia. He was born August 30, 1958 in Cleveland, OH.

Johnny, “John Boy”, “JB”, “John” was the embodiment of unconditional love, there was room in his heart for everyone. He was a powerful force of compassion and empathy, and he offered his heart and soul to the service of others.

John’s life-long passion was commercial net fishing. He persevered through the Net Ban and adapted to the much smaller “legal” nets to continue doing what was most dear to him; making a living on the water and the freedom to fish. John treasured each head of fish that came onto his boat, he was appreciative and respectful of his catch. The clear pure energy one experienced while eating his fish was evidence of John’s reverence for the water.

John’s Uncle Robert Whidden and Aunt June owned the Bokeelia Fish Company and the Seabreeze restaurant (Capt’n Con’s) where John lived for a time. Richard Lolly taught John how to fish for spotted sea trout and other species. Richard and his wife Judy took John into their home and helped to raise him. The lives of the older and contemporary fishermen were interwoven into John’s life throughout his career as a commercial fisherman. John also crewed on the large boats in the Keys, on the East and West Coasts of Florida and Corn Island, Nicaragua. For many years John worked with his wife doing landscape maintenance in the Seagull Bay Community in Bokeelia. The Jugg Creek Fish House, owners (past and present) Joey and Virginia Morton, Suzanne and Steve, the employees, the fisherman, have all been an immeasurable part of John’s life as were his many friends and family.
